How to get from Battersea Park to Stoke Newington by Tube and bus?
By Tube and bus
To get from Battersea Park to Stoke Newington in Stamford Hill, you’ll need to take 2 bus lines and one Tube line: take the 344 bus from Battersea Park Station (A) station to Vauxhall Bus Station (J) station. Next, you’ll have to switch to the VICTORIA Tube and finally take the 76 bus from Seven Sisters Station (K) station to Stoke Newington Station (C) station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 53 min. The ride fare is £4.75.
